Phlebotomy Technician/Phlebotomist at Concorde Career Institute-Miramar

Concorde Career Institute-Miramar conferred 31 completions in phlebotomy technician/phlebotomist in the latest year of data — 84% to women and 16% to men. The most common background among these graduates was Black or African American (23%).

Sterile Processing Technology/Technician at Concorde Career Institute-Miramar

Concorde Career Institute-Miramar awarded 20 degrees in sterile processing technology/technician recently — 95% to women and 5% to men. Most of these graduates identified as Black or African American (65%).
